Oscar "Occi" R. Cushing, Jr, 88, of 65 Loon Lake Rd., Plymouth, passed away peacefully in his sleep at the home of his daughter and son-in-law, Edith and Ray Barlow, on June 27, 2009.Born on September 20, 1921, he was the son of the late Oscar R. and Ethel (Thompson) Cushing Sr. Oscar attended Plymouth Schools graduating from Plymouth High School.After graduating high school he joined the military where he proudly fought for his country in WWII. He achieved the rank of Sargeant in the Army and National Guard."Occi" worked for many years as an auto body mechanic for McCormick Motors in Holderness, and then Kelley's Autobody of West Plymouth.He is predeceased by his two brothers, Freddy and Roger Cushing, and two sisters, Doris Joyce and Marian Ray.Oscar leaves behind his beloved wife of 50 years, Eleanor M.
